§ 23-14-65-7 — Permanent maintenance fund
Indiana·Title 23 BUSINESS AND OTHER ASSOCIATIONS·Art. 14 CEMETERY ASSOCIATIONS·Ch. 65 City and Town Cemeteries
(a)Part of the proceeds derived from the sale
of lots within a cemetery to which this chapter applies may be set aside
as a permanent maintenance fund.
(b)Not more than fifty percent (50%) of the proceeds from the sale
of lots may be set aside as a permanent maintenance fund under this
section.
(c)The income from a permanent maintenance fund established
under this section shall remain in the fund, except as provided in
subsection (d).
(d)If the revenue from the sale of lots and other income from a
cemetery to which this chapter applies becomes insufficient to meet the
expense of maintaining the cemetery, income derived from the fund
and its accretions may be used in whole or in part as the needs of the
cemetery require, after appropriation by the legislative body according
to statute.

Legislative History
As added by P.L.52-1997, SEC.39.
